Cypriot vs Comanche Family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 61,784,976 people shows a mild negative correlation between the proportion of Cypriots and poverty level among families in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.373 and weighted average of 7.3%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 109,722,823 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of Comanche and poverty level among families in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.506 and weighted average of 11.0%, a difference of 50.5%.
